专栏
标签
请问在文本建模中,例如反应堆一回路构建,其中有堆芯,蒸汽发生器,泵等组件
一般问题
发布于 2024-11-11 12:58:54
查看 13过去594天

如果把他们放到同一个文件中代码太长了,不太方便调用,而之前我尝试将他们分别划分为几个模块,但是这几个模块只能通过一些变量来彼此连接。但是它们之间共用的变量太多了,例如堆芯可能要提供功率,温度等一系列指标。
有什么方法,能节省一大堆连接器,将声明变量单独分为一个模块,eqution分别为多个模块,它们之间共用变量呢?

所属专栏:Sysplorer基础平台
产品信息:Sysplorer系统建模仿真环境
系统建模
采纳的回答
发布于 2024-11-11 13:56:30

您好,您可以使用通过定义partial类与继承(extends)重用的方式来实现。
1.新建model,并定义为partial类,在此模型中添加通用的变量、参数、接口和方程等;

2.新建model,使用extends继承所定义partial类,继承后相当于把partial类中的代码复制到了本模型中,您可以在此基础上进行开发

全部回答 1

发布于 2024-11-11 13:56:30

您好,您可以使用通过定义partial类与继承(extends)重用的方式来实现。
1.新建model,并定义为partial类,在此模型中添加通用的变量、参数、接口和方程等;

2.新建model,使用extends继承所定义partial类,继承后相当于把partial类中的代码复制到了本模型中,您可以在此基础上进行开发

用户
和原帖交流更多问题细节吧,去
我要发帖 我要发帖
资料中心 资料中心
查看更多>
热门帖子 热门帖子
主要贡献者 主要贡献者
过去7天